Bulldogs Split With King Cove In Non-Divisional Basketball

Author: Coach Dan Gensel |

King Cove continued its whirl-wind, road trip through Southcentral Alaska with a pair of non-divisional games at Nikiski High School on Wednesday; the King Cove Rookie girls defeating Nikiski 48-42 and the Nikiski boys downing the King Cove T-Jacks 67-43.

 

Nikiski Girls 42 – King Cove 48

Lead by a 27 point effort by Elaina Mack, the Rookies held off Nikiski 48-42 in non-conference basketball between the 1A reigning state champions and the 3A reigning state runner-up Bulldogs.  Nikiski lead 15-9 after one quarter and King Cove took the lead 26-24 at the half.  The Rookies built a nine point lead after three quarters 42-31.  Lillian Carstens lead Nikiski with 14 points.

Nikiski 67 – King Cove 43

The Nikiski boys, on the strength of six, three-point baskets in the first quarter, built a 25-10 lead in the first and cruised to a 67-43 victory over the King Cover T-Jack boys.  Noah Litke lead Nikiski with 24 points, including six, three-pointers; Michael Mysing scored eight points, all in the first quarter.

 

Nikiski travels to Nome to face the 3A Nome Nanooks on Friday and Saturday, February 14-15.  Friday’s games are scheduled for 7 & 8:30 p.m. with the boys varsity playing the first game.  Saturday’s schedule is for 4 & 5:30 p.m. with the girls varsity leading off.
